Millus was a 30 year editorial writer for the New York Herald Tribune which was known for its coverage of international news. Before it folded in 1966 it had won 12 Pulitzer prizes. This book is not a history of the US invovlement in WWI but the history of HOW we got involved. Book ends when we declared war. MIllis was much AGAINST our getting involved. Millis was a revisiobist historian. He'd written a previous book on the Spanish American war. It showed how "..our fighting ferver was fanned by the Yellow Press and party politics to a point that finally led the American people to force a war of conquest upon the helpless Spaniards from the very highest motives." This quote is from a review of that book printed on the rear DJ flap. .
